## Idempotency Keys for Payment Retries (Lumopay)

Every retry of a charge request must reuse the original idempotency key; generating a new key on retry can produce duplicate charges. Keys are scoped per merchant and expire after 48 hours. Reviewers should verify keys are derived server-side, never from client input. The full key-generation specification and threat model are maintained on the internal page.

dashboard of kaguf-tawip = https://vault.merlaqsys.test/issue

== Key-card stock transport — Ferndown Annex ==

Heads up for the receiving site: the blank key-card stock for the new Ferndown Annex travels in a sealed tamper-evident pouch, never loose in a mail bag. Count the pouch seals on arrival and log them straight away. The courier hand-over itself follows the confidential instruction below.

dispatch memo: the lamwyn fenwyn courier leaves the wenir ledger at gate 7175 under passcode 822969

Ticket: Staging env misconfigured for Siftgate bloom filter

The bloom layer in front of the Pellet KV store is rejecting all lookups in staging because the env file was copied from the dev template without credentials. False-positive tuning values are fine; only the auth line is missing. To unblock the weekly demo, the Pellet admission secret must be set on the following line.

env line for yaguf-fajop: LEDGER_TOKEN13=fb08984397349

Subject: Lost-badge procedure

Facilities,

Reminder from the front desk at Osterfell Works: lost badges must be reported to us within the hour. We deactivate the badge, log it, and issue a day pass. Do not lend spares from the drawer — that stops today. Temporary passes are kept in the secure cabinet behind reception. The cabinet opens with the code below.

staff pass of kawip-hawef = bdg-QLP-2